Output d7bcaeec30cb0e4fbdcc7997543a4d940316fd53269093135e1a904d24af739f: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41f53b997822811816986a33b23c9336392cfdda OP_EQUAL
address
37hmd61Kpd2yqtXzmWh4GNnvYhxGAx8e1b
transaction
d7bcaeec30cb0e4fbdcc7997543a4d940316fd53269093135e1a904d24af739f
confirmations
422285
spent
true